An example of ladder programming that uses a motion command (torque command code = 24)
to perform torque control is shown in the following figures.
When torque control is performed, a speed limit is applied to keep the speed from accelerating
more than necessary.
Line 3: The torque command code is set in the motion command register.
Line 4: The speed limit is specified.
Line 5: The torque reference value is set in DW00001. Lines 12 to 15 apply a filter to the refer-
ence value.
Lines 12 to 15: A first order lag filter is applied to the torque reference value. The first order lag
time constant is three seconds.
